How Reliable is the Ford Transit Connect?

Based on 3,622,068 MOT tests across 283,952 vehicles.

70.3%
Pass Rate
7,948
Miles/Year
24
Year Lifespan
283,952
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Registration plate lamp not working 121,813
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 105,772
Stop lamp not working 69,148
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 67,188
Brake pipe excessively corroded 66,256

AO55 VSC is a 2005 Ford Transit Connect in White with a 1,753c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.

Across all 2005 Ford Transit Connect models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.7% with a typical mileage of 102,650 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ford Transit Connect f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 121,813 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AO55 VSC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Transit Connect typ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 21 years old, this Ford Transit Connect is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
